The Random Access Memory (RAM) is an important part of computers, servers and other electronic devices. Generally it is much faster than the permanent storage memory of your device and all information stored in it will be lost when you switch off your device. Extra RAM is often an affordable and efficient way to upgrade your slightly outdated device, so you can use it another year.

  • - PC/Server 8 GB DDR3 1600 MHz
  • - 240-pin DIMM 2 x 4 GB
  • - CAS latency: 8
  • - 1.5 V
